SIT set up to trace missing youth from Kandra begins  working on suicide angle

KUMUD JENAMANI

 

Jamshedpur, Oct 4: Manish Agarwal, 29, who has gone missing from Adityapur since September 23 continues to keep the police guessing about his whereabouts.

 

A special investigation team (SIT) which has been set up to trace out the youth is now working on the suicide angle for the missing youth.

Sub-divisional police officer (SDPO) Chandil, Sanjay Kumar Singh who is heading the SIT said the youth in question might have committed suicide.

“From Manish’s laptop and talks with his friends, it was found that he was searching methods of suicide since few days before he went missing on September 23. We have, therefore, started looking into the suicide angle behind his disappearance, ” said Singh.

The SIT head stated that as during investigation Manish was seen last time while getting down from an auto-rickshaw close to Kharkai river, they tended to assume that he must have taken a plunge in the river for the suicide.

“We are, therefore, carrying out a search in both Kharkai and Subarnarekha rivers for the body.  The SIT had on Monday gone over to Ghatsila while searching the body in the Subarnarekha, but could not find it in the swollen river, ” said the SDPO.

According to Singh, Manish is suffering from bone TB for the past one year and finds it very painful in sitting and even sleeping due to the disease.

The only son of a Kandra-based trader, Debu Agarwal was scheduled to get married in November and engagement to this effect had already performed in July.

A senior official in the SIT said from the investigation it is learnt that the missing youth was not interested in the marriage due to his disease.

Meanwhile, health minister Banna Gupta had on Monday visited the family members of the missing youth and assured them that the administration would trace Manish soon.
